Abstract

The cluster approach is one of the basic methods to pattern classification and system modeling. The clustering target is that according to some rules, divide the sample data set in the sample space into some subsets indicating different patterns or system behavior[1].In the course of establishing the video image indexing, every step from building index according to the basic visual characters of extracted images, to forming category index trough extracting related programs, uses the clustering thought. So, how to choose a suitable effective clustering algorithm will directly affect the efficency to establish the video image indexing and the performance of the whole management system. The k-means clustering algorithm is a relatively good one.
